JEE Mains 2023 Result LIVE: JEE Session 2 results awaited at jeemain.nta.nic.in

JEE Mains 2023 Result Live Updates: National Testing Agency, NTA will release JEE Mains 2023 Result soon. The results for Joint Entrance Examination can be checked by candidates on the official site of NTA JEE at jeemain.nta.nic.in and also on nta.ac.in. JEE Mains 2023 Result Live Updates(Keshav Singh/HT File) Along with the results, the Agency will announce the toppers, cut off marks, percentile and other details which can be fetched on the official website of NTA at nta.ac.in. JEE Mains Session 2 Exam 2023 was conducted by NTA on April 6, 8, 10, 11, 12, 13 and 15, 2023. The answer key was released on April 19 and the last date to raise objections was till April 21, 2023.The final provisional answer key was released on April 24, 2023. Check latest updates on results, scorecard, cut offs and toppers below. For admission to NITs, IIITs and other centrally funded institutions based on JEE Main, candidates have to apply for JoSAA and/or CSAB counselling. JoSAA couselling is also a single-window for admission to IITs and it begins after JEE Advanced result is declared. CSAB counselling is held once seat allocation through JoSAA is over. JEE MAIN 2023

The results will be based on the JEE Main 2023 final answer key released on 24 April 2023 The Joint Entrance Examination (JEE) Main 2023 session 2 result is expected to be announced today. Candidates who appeared for the JEE Main 2023 session 2 exam will be able to check the BTech final answer key. The National Testing Agency (NTA) has dropped a total of 10 questions from all the shifts combined. NTA will be hosting JEE Main 2023 result session 2 link on the official website – jeemain.nta.nic.in. The results will be based on the JEE Main 2023 final answer key released on 24 April 2023. The NTA informed the candidates that there will be no revaluation of the result. Along with JEE Main result 2023 session 2, the agency will also be declaring the JEE Main 2023 category-wise cut-off and toppers list. JEE Main 2023 session 2 provisional answer key was issued on 19 April. Candidates were able to challenge the provisional answer key till 21 April. JEE Main 2023 session 2 exam was conducted on 6, 8, 10, 11, 12, 13, and 15 April.

JEE Mains Result 2022 (DECLARED) LIVE: Session 2 result OUT, check cut off, toppers' list and more here

JEE Mains Result 2022 Live updates: The National Testing Agency, NTA released the Joint Entrance Examination, JEE Main Results 2022 today, August 8. Candidates can now check their JEE Main results on the official websitejee.nta.ac.in. NTA will soon release the JEE Main cut off and toppers' list on the official website.Click here for JEE Advanced 2022 Registration- Eligibility Criteria Candidates who wish to apply for JEE Advanced should attain rank among top 2,50,000 in JEE Main Reults 2022 . The percentages of various categories of candidates to be shortlisted are: 10% for GEN-EWS, 27% for OBC-NCL, 15% for SC, 7.5% for ST, and the remaining 40.5% is OPEN for all. Within each of these five categories, 5% horizontal reservation is available for PwD candidates. JEE Main 2023 Result: Session 2 Result Soon At Jeemain.nta.nic.in, Here's How To Check

JEE Main 2023 Result: The National Testing Agency (NTA) is expected to release the JEE Main 2023 Session 2 Result anytime soon. JEE Main 2023 session 2 result for paper 1 and 2 will be released on the official website – jeemain.nta.nic.in. Once declared, candidates will be able to check their results through the application number and date of birth. Nearly 9.5 lakh candidates are waiting for their results. The To prevent the bunching effect, the NTA will calculate the JEE Main 2023 percentile scores with precision up to seven decimal places. Meeting the JEE Main 2023 cut-off is a prerequisite for students who aspire to appear for JEE Advanced 2023, scheduled for June 4. Once the JEE Main result 2023 and cut-offs are declared by the NTA, institutions that admit students based on JEE Main scores will initiate the JEE Main counselling and seat allotment procedure. The Joint Seat Allocation Authority (JoSAA) will oversee the JEE Main 2023 counselling process. How To Check JEE Main 2023 Session 2 Result? • Visit JEE Main's official website – jeemain.nta.nic.in. • On the homepage, click on the ‘JEE Mains 2023 session 2 result’ link. • Login using the application number, password and security pin. • JEE Main 2023 result will appear on your screen. • Check JEE Main Result, download it and take a printout for future reference.
